Northern Cyprus Weather Gradually Improving: Forecast for February 25
According to the TRNC Meteorology Department, high pressure and cold, humid air will continue to affect Northern Cyprus on Tuesday, February 25. Forecasters predict cloudy skies but no rainfall. While temperatures will still be 2-3°C below the seasonal average, they will be noticeably warmer compared to the previous day, ranging between 7°C and 14°C in most areas. A moderate northwesterly wind is expected.
Regional Forecast for February 25:
- Northern Coast: Kyrenia – 12°C, Lapta – 11°C, Akdeniz – 12°C, Alevkaya – 7°C, Esentepe – 10°C
- Western Coast: Lefke – 12°C, Güzelyurt – 14°C
- Central Region: Nicosia – 13°C, Ercan – 13°C
- Eastern Coast: Famagusta – 14°C, İskele – 14°C
- Karpas Peninsula: Yeni Erenköy – 12°C
